Hull Shared Lives Scheme is a dementia care provider in Kingston upon Hull, City of, Yorkshire and The Humber. Providing specialist dementia care for adults of all ages. The service also supports people with Learning disabilities, Mental health conditions, and Physical disabilities. Hull Shared Lives Scheme has a CQC rating of Requires improvement.
